Hey Marisol — handing off the session-token refresh bug in Quillgate before I'm out. Tokens expire mid-refresh when the Loomhaven cluster clock skews past 30s; fix is staged behind the fallow_refresh flag. Dev notes are in the Tamsin runbook, nothing merged yet. For the release manager: to unlock the staging credentials vault, use the recovery passphrase below.

vault phrase of kahap-bagug = novvan-istir-holael-oliwyn-fraath-tamius-zorael-fenok-oliir

Subject: Lease talks — quick update

Hi all,

Quick heads-up for finance: we've reopened the lease on the Harrowfield office with Pendleby Properties. They're open to a three-year extension with a rent step-down if we commit early. Marla is modeling the scenarios and will circulate figures Friday. Please hold any space-planning spend until then. For context on why timing matters, see the confidential note below.

board note of kageg-bahof: The renewal with Holwynax Holdings closes at $2 million a year, 5 percent below the last contract. Project Ulaath slips by two quarters because of the supplier delay.

## Step 4: Sync your build agents

Heads up, new folks: the Larkspur build agents drift. If agent clocks differ by more than 30 seconds, artifact signing on Pindrop fails with a cryptic "stale manifest" error. Before deploying, run the skew checker and let chrony settle for a minute. Once the agents agree on the time, open the deploy env file and add the signing credential on the next line.

sealed setting: VAULT_KEY13=741e0a90de233

CI troubleshooting — QuickAddr autocomplete widget. If the suggestion-dropdown e2e tests flake, it's almost always the mock geocoder container starting slowly; the widget times out and falls back to manual entry, which the assertions hate. Bump the container health-check wait in the pipeline config before blaming the widget itself. Also clear the cached suggestion index between runs, or stale entries from Brindlemoor test data leak in. When escalating to the platform crew, quote the build token printed below.

trace token, hadup-kafof: htk14_fef3ca2e878e64